About the book

In «A Dialoge or Communication of Two Persons,» Desiderius Erasmus presents a profound exploration of human nature, morality, and society through a dynamic exchange between two characters. Employing a conversational style characterized by wit and eloquence, Erasmus navigates themes of ethics, education, and religious beliefs, reflecting the intellectual currents of the Renaissance. The dialogue format not only engages the reader but also serves as a vehicle for Erasmus to critique the prevailing social norms and dogmas of his time, making the work a notable contribution to humanist thought and early modern philosophical discourse. Desiderius Erasmus, a Dutch philosopher and theologian, is heralded as one of the foremost scholars of the Renaissance. His experiences in a rapidly changing Europe, marked by both the tumult of the Reformation and a growing emphasis on humanism, significantly shaped his views on religion and morality. Engaging with classical texts and the complexities of Christian doctrine, Erasmus aimed to advocate for a more rational and less dogmatic approach to spirituality, which is vividly encapsulated in this dialogue. For readers seeking a thoughtful examination of humanist perspectives and the interplay of ethical dilemmas, «A Dialoge or Communication of Two Persons» is an essential read. Erasmus's masterful blend of engaging dialogue and philosophical inquiry invites readers to reflect on their values, making it a timeless exploration of the human condition.
